Pest Fumigation Service Questions
What pests can pest fumigation target? Fumigation effectively treats a variety of pests including termites, bed bugs, fleas, and stored product insects.
Is pest fumigation safe for my home? Fumigation is performed using controlled methods to minimize risks, ensuring safety for the property and occupants during and after treatment.
How often should pest fumigation be performed? The frequency depends on the pest problem and property conditions; a professional assessment can determine the appropriate schedule.
What preparations are needed before pest fumigation? Preparations typically include removing food, personal items, and covering or sealing certain areas as advised by the technician.
